WebThe basics of this problem is a gram -> mol -> molecule conversion with one extra step. Since the problem gives you a name you must first find the formula of carbon dioxide which is CO2. So to go from grams to moles, we divide by the molar mass of CO2 (44 g/mol) and then we multiply by 6.02*10^23 molecules/mol. WebJul 21, 2024 · Obtain the atomic masses of each element from the periodic table and multiply the atomic mass of each element by the number of atoms of that element. 1 C atom = 12.011 amu. 1 H atom = 1.0079 amu. 1 O atom = 15.9994 amu. Add the masses together to obtain the molecular mass. 2C: (2 atoms) (12.011amu/atom) = 24.022 amu.
